This afternoon, in keeping with the spirit, I needed something Christmassy for tea.  Not wanting to venture out of doors, I scoured the cupboards and came up with a really yummy Christmas tea.  I call it Candy Cane Tea, for obvious reasons:

Candy Cane Tea
1/2 stick of cinnamon
1/2 tsp grated orange peel
1 tsp tea leaves

Xmas_teacup2 Steep cinnamon, orange peel and tea leaves together for 5 minutes.  Pour into cup.  Drop in one small candy cane.  I don't know if you can see in the picture, but the candy cane melting turned my golden tea red. 

Note: you can use dried orange peel from the spice section of your grocery store instead of fresh orange peel. 

Also, I used golden yunnan for the tea, and it is truly delish.
